The Yang di-Pertuan Agong portal is developed to fulfill the need for general knowledge concerning the institution of the Yang di-Pertuan Agong. The portal is developed for the purpose of providing information that is both authoritative and comprehensive so that the people can understand the Yang di-Pertuan Agong’s position in the Federal Constitution. This understanding is important for nurturing the feelings of love and loyalty towards the ruler and the nation.

    STATUS AND POWERS  
       
    What is the position and what are the powers of His Majesty the Yang di-Pertuan Agong in the Malaysian Constitution?  
   
  • This section explains in detail the function of the Yang di-Pertuan Agong as Head of State, that is Executive, Legislative and Judiciary. It also explains the other important duties of the Yang di-Pertuan Agong like safeguarding the special rights of Malays, granting royal pardons, and holding the position of the Supreme Commander of the Armed Forces. It also includes matters outside the purview of the Yang di-Pertuan Agong.

    ROYAL REGALIA  
       
    What are the Royal Regalia found in Istana Negara?  
   
  • A list of The Royal Regalia is found in this section. The background, origin, how and when these items are used are also explained in detail. The various ways to wear and fashion the tengkolok (the royal head-dress)like Lang Menyususn Angin, Garam Sebuku Dendam Tak Sudah etc as well as the Queen’s necklace that can be taken apart into earrings, brooches and studs are among the interesting material that can be seen in this section. These items are also shown in 3D form for a clearer and brighter picture.

    ROYAL AND PALACE CUSTOMS  
       
    What are the Royal and Palace Customs observed at Istana Negara?  
   
  • There are various customs that need to be publicly known like the audience with the king by members of the public, uniformed officials, speaking conventions, seating protocol and dining etiquette. The dress code when attending palace ceremonies and functions, the etiquette when dining with the Yang di-Pertuan Agong as well as many others are explained in great detail in this section. The type of spoken language used during an audience, preparing the speech of allegiace and how to write a letter to the Yang di-Pertuan Agong are also part of the interesting information that need to be known and which can be found in this section.

    FEDERAL AWARDS AND HONOURS  
       
    What are the federation awards?  
   
  • The Federation Awards are usually conferred during His Majesty the Yang di\-Pertuan Agong’s Birthday or whenever is appropriate. Among the awards are those categorized by seniority, by type, title-carrying awards, awards of limited quantity and awards that are in the federation hierarchy list. It also explains the criteria for nomination to get an Award, rules governing the use of the award and a list of recipients.

    NATIONAL PALACE  
       
    Curious about the Istana Negara?  
   
  • Istana Negara is the official residence of His Majesty the Yang di-Pertuan Agong and Her Majesty the Raja Permaisuri Agong. There are two categories of areas in the Istana Negara, i.e. the area arround the building housing the Throne Room, the Banquet Hall, the Conference Room of the Council of Rulers, Small Audience Room, Ambassadors’ Room, Small Throne Room, Queen’s Room, Ministers’ Room and Throne Room. The area outside the Istana Negara are the Istana Gardens and Istana Square. The functions of each area are explained in detail in this section.
